In new legal documents, Hunter Biden, the son of former President Joe Biden, has revealed that he is currently unable to find suitable housing for himself, his wife, and their child. The 55-year-old claims that the $4 million rental home in Malibu, where they resided, has become unlivable due to the devastating impact of recent California wildfires.
Biden's situation has drawn attention as he describes the challenges he faces in securing a new place to live. The wildfires have not only affected the physical structure of the rental property but have also left him in a precarious financial position.
